Join the Friends of Lincoln Park as we work to bring the beautiful mature forest of our park into restoration. Lincoln Park, on the shores of Puget Sound, includes 80 acres of forest. Unfortunately, our Seattle forests are threatened by nonnative, invasive plants. We promise you a good workout AND good karma! Kids welcome!

SOUTHWEST STORIES – SCHURMAN ROCK: Learn about the history of Camp Long and Schurman Rock in Jeff Smoot‘s talk presented by the Southwest Seattle Historical Society, 2 pm at High Point Library. (3411 SW Raymond)
